Kennedy Meeks Efficient in Victory


has emerged as No. 24 North Carolina’s most efficient scoring option 10 games into his sophomore season. Meeks led UNC with 18 points on 8-of-9 shooting in Tuesday’s 79-56 win over UNCG at the Greensboro Coliseum. The double-digit scoring effort marks his eighth of the season, which is tops on the team along with his 13.8 points-per-game average. (Inside Carolina)
